DIY Fall Wreath Decor

DIY fall wreath

I told myself that I wasn’t going to make any fall-related crafts until September, but I couldn’t help myself. I saw the autumn leaf decor at Pat Catan’s today and wanted to use it to make a Fall wreath.  I love the colors!

It took about an hour to make and the materials cost about $12. Not too bad if you ask me!fall wreath materials

Things You Will Need

Water
Ribbon
Burlap
Newspaper
Paint brush
Acrylic paint
Wreath base
Wooden letters
Hot-melt glue
Hot-melt glue gun

painted wooden letters for fall

Step 1

Paint your letters and let them dry.

autumn leavesfor fall wreath

Step 2

In the meantime you can wrap your autumn leaves around your wreath base and glue them into place.

burlap wreath decoration

Step 3

Cut a piece of burlap long enough to stretch across your wreath and wrap about the back.

Glue it tightly into place.

wooden letter decor on wreath

Step 4

Glue your letters across the burlap so they stretch across the length of the wreath.

DIY fall wreath

Tie on your ribbon and hang up your new fall wreath!
